Using Google Font Menu

Open your Google Sheets document and click on the Font menu in the toolbar. At the top of the Font menu, click "More fonts." This opens a new window with hundreds of available fonts. Use the search and filtering options to find specific fonts. Click a font to add it to your list. The selected font will appear under "My Fonts" on the right side of the window. You can add as many fonts as you want. When you're done, click "OK." The new fonts will now be available in the Font menu of Google Sheets.

Changing Fonts in Google Sheets

Google Sheets provides a font dropdown in the theme customizer which includes a selection of available fonts. You can set a font not listed in the dropdown by using ctrl+A to select all cells, then manually setting the font to your choice. This allows customization beyond the predefined options in the dropdown menu.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I upload a custom font to Google Sheets?

You cannot upload custom fonts directly to Google Sheets. Custom fonts can be uploaded to Google Docs via Google Drive, but not to Google Sheets.

Can I use the Google Fonts API in Google Sheets?

No, the Google Fonts API is designed for use in web pages and does not apply to Google Sheets.

What steps are needed to change the font in Google Sheets?

To change the font in Google Sheets, go to theme, customize the theme, or use the ctrl+A shortcut and then choose the desired font.

Is it possible to upload fonts to Google Sheets?

No, it is not possible to upload custom fonts to Google Sheets.

Can I set the default font in Google Sheets?

Yes, you can change the default font in Google Sheets by customizing the theme.
